The Problem: why Are Readmissions So High?
The core issue lies in the fragmented nature of care.Often, crucial discharge instructions aren’t consistently followed onc a patient enters a SNF. This can be due to a lack of specialized support, insufficient communication between care teams, or simply the complexities of managing recovery in a new environment.
Here’s what’s at stake for your hospital:
* CMS Penalties: The Centers for med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) directly ties Medicare payments to hospital performance, including readmission rates.
* Financial Strain: High readmissions translate to millions in lost revenue and increased costs.
* Reputational Risk: Poor patient outcomes can damage your hospital’s reputation.
Puzzle Healthcare’s Solution: A 90-Day Safety Net
Puzzle Healthcare isn’t just another referral service. They offer a longitudinal, embedded care model that extends far beyond the initial SNF admission. They essentially act as an extension of the hospital’s care team, ensuring a smooth and supported transition.
Here’s how it effectively works:
* In-Facility Support: Puzzle assigns dedicated disease-specific care managers and physiatrists (rehabilitation medicine specialists) to work within the SNF alongside existing staff.
* Extended Coordination: Crucially, Puzzle’s support doesn’t end when the patient leaves the SNF. They continue to manage the patient’s care for a full 90 days post-discharge – the most vulnerable period for readmission.
This proactive approach ensures discharge instructions are followed,potential complications are addressed early,and patients receive the ongoing support they need to thrive at home.
scaling for Impact: Puzzle’s Strategic Growth
What sets Puzzle Healthcare apart is that they’re already operating at scale. This isn’t a startup testing a concept; it’s a proven model with a strong track record.
Consider these key facts:
* Current Reach: Puzzle Healthcare currently operates in 230 skilled nursing facilities across 15 states.
* Patient Volume: In Michigan alone, they manage up to 24,000 patients annually.
* Hospital Partnerships: They’ve established partnerships with over 60 hospitals, becoming the preferred downstream partner for patient transitions.
This strategic alignment with hospital systems is a game-changer. By partnering with hospitals first, Puzzle effectively directs patients to SNFs already integrated with their platform, creating a seamless care continuum.
Why HCAP Partners Invested: A Vote of confidence in Value-Based Care
HCAP Partners’ investment isn’t just about financial returns; it’s a strong endorsement of Puzzle Healthcare’s vision for the future of post-acute care. As Hope Mago, Partner at HCAP Partners, stated, “Puzzle’s model is a strong fit for our healthcare investment thesis focused on improving quality while lowering the cost of care.”
This investment signals a clear trend: the future of healthcare is “accountable.” Value-based care models are expanding, and SNFs can no longer operate as isolated entities. They must be data-integrated extensions of the hospital system, actively participating in coordinated care.
